Portland police officer Jakhary Jackson was interviewed by KGW8 TV in Oregon.. The subject was the perspective of being a black officer policing the violent Portland protests .

We will let his words speak for themselves, it’s quite enlightening.

Jackson said that white protesters routinely behave in a condescending manner and scream at cops, telling them to quit the force. “Having people tell you what to do with your life, that you need to quit your job. Saying you’re hurting your community but they’re not even part of the community. And you as a privileged white person telling a person of color what to do with their life – and you don’t even know what I’ve dealt with or what these white officers that you’re screaming at — you don’t know them. You don’t know anything about them,” he said.

“It says something when you’re at a Black Lives Matter protest and you have more minorities on the police side than you have in a violent crowd,” Jackson explained. “You have white people screaming at black officers, ‘you have the biggest nose I’ve ever seen!’ You hear these things and you go, ‘are they gonna say something to this person?’ No.
